This Whistler Village hotel features an outdoor swimming pool and a hot tub. A spa tub and a gas fireplace provide added comfort in all rooms. Free Wi-Fi is included. The Eco Chic Spa is 260 ft away.
A full kitchen and a dining table feature in every room at the Pinnacle Hotel Whistler. A flat-screen cable TV and a DVD player are provided. A balcony is featured in each room. Local calls are also included.
Quattro Italian Restaurant provides dining options 7 days a week. Alta Bistro features a seasonal dinner menu with locally-sourced products.
Ski and snowboard rental is available at Whistler Pinnacle. A fitness room is provided for guest use. The public shuttle bus stop is located outside the hotel. Underground parking is available for an extra fee.
Skiers Plaza is a 10-minute walk from this hotel. Lost Lake is just over 1 mile away.
